<p>Before diving into specific features, it is vital to comprehend that “finest” is subjective and mostly depends on lifestyle. A household living in a fifth-floor city apartment or condo requires a various option than a household residing in a backwoods with gravel paths.</p>

<h3 id="1-travel-systems" id="1-travel-systems">1. Travel Systems</h3>

<p>Travel systems are detailed bundles that include a pushchair chassis, a compatible infant safety seat, and typically a carrycot. These are ideal for babies, permitting a seamless transition from the vehicle to the stroller without waking the child.</p>

<h3 id="2-lightweight-and-umbrella-strollers" id="2-lightweight-and-umbrella-strollers">2. Lightweight and Umbrella Strollers</h3>

<p>Created for portability, these are best for older infants and toddlers. They often include a simple folding system and are lightweight enough for public transport or air travel.</p>

<h3 id="3-all-terrain-pushchairs" id="3-all-terrain-pushchairs">3. All-Terrain Pushchairs</h3>

<p>Equipped with larger, air-filled, or puncture-proof tires and improved suspension, these are constructed for off-road environments. They are usually much heavier but use the best ride on irregular surface areas.</p>

<h3 id="4-double-and-tandem-pushchairs" id="4-double-and-tandem-pushchairs">4. Double and Tandem Pushchairs</h3>

<p>For those with twins or children of different ages, double pushchairs (side-by-side) or tandems (one child behind or under the other) are necessary. Modern develops strive to keep these as narrow as possible to fit through basic doorways.</p>

<p>When assessing the “best” pushchair, specific technical specifications and design components stand apart as indicators of quality and longevity.</p>

<h3 id="chassis-and-build-quality" id="chassis-and-build-quality">Chassis and Build Quality</h3>

<p>The frame (chassis) is the backbone of the pushchair. High-end designs generally utilize aluminum or magnesium alloys, which offer a balance of strength and lightness. A well-constructed chassis should feel strong rather than “rattly” when pushed.</p>

<h3 id="wheel-design-and-suspension" id="wheel-design-and-suspension">Wheel Design and Suspension</h3>

<p>Wheels dictate the “push-ability” of the system.</p>
<ul><li><strong>Swivel Wheels:</strong> Essential for urban environments, enabling for 360-degree turns in tight spaces.</li>
<li><strong>Repaired Wheels:</strong> Better for running or rough terrain as they provide a steady line of travel.</li>
<li><strong>Suspension:</strong> Look for all-wheel suspension to take in shocks from broken pavements or tree roots.</li></ul>

<h3 id="the-fold-mechanism" id="the-fold-mechanism">The Fold Mechanism</h3>

<p>Area is typically at a premium. <a href="https://www.pushchairsandprams.uk/">pushchairsandprams.uk</a> include a “one-hand fold,” enabling a moms and dad to collapse the system while holding a kid. It is also crucial to inspect the “folded measurements” to guarantee it fits into the vehicle&#39;s luggage compartment.</p>

<h3 id="seating-and-comfort" id="seating-and-comfort">Seating and Comfort</h3>

<p>For newborns, a “lie-flat” position is non-negotiable for spine advancement and air passage safety. For older children, the seat ought to offer multiple recline positions and adjustable footrests.</p>

<p>Security Standards and Regulations</p>

<hr>

<p>No matter the features, safety stays the critical concern. In the UK and Europe, pushchairs must satisfy the <strong>EN 1888</strong> security standard. This makes sure the product has actually gone through rigorous testing for stability, braking systems, and the strength of the harness.</p>

<p><strong>Safety Checkpoints:</strong></p>
<ol><li><strong>Five-Point Harness:</strong> This is the gold standard, securing the child at the shoulders, waist, and between the legs.</li>
<li><strong>Brake Accessibility:</strong> The brake ought to be easy to engage and disengage, ideally with a “flip-flop friendly” style.</li>
<li><strong>No Finger Traps:</strong> The folding joints must be created to avoid little fingers from getting captured during operation.</li></ol>

<p>To ensure a pushchair remains in leading condition, routine maintenance is needed.</p>
<ul><li><strong>Wheel Care:</strong> Mud and grit need to be cleaned off to prevent the swivel mechanism from seizing. For pneumatic tires, pressure should be examined monthly.</li>
<li><strong>Fabric Care:</strong> Most contemporary pushchairs feature removable, machine-washable covers. Nevertheless, routine spot-cleaning avoids discolorations from setting.</li>
<li><strong>Joint Lubrication:</strong> Using a silicone-based spray on moving joints can prevent squeaking and guarantee the folding system remains smooth.</li></ul>

<p>Regularly Asked Questions (FAQ)</p>

<hr>

<h3 id="at-what-age-can-a-baby-sit-in-a-pushchair" id="at-what-age-can-a-baby-sit-in-a-pushchair">At what age can a baby sit in a pushchair?</h3>

<p>A child can typically being in a basic pushchair seat from 6 months of age, or once they have acquired enough neck and back strength to sit unaided. Prior to this, a lie-flat carrycot or a suitable cars and truck seat must be utilized.</p>

<h3 id="are-air-filled-tires-better-than-foam-filled-tires" id="are-air-filled-tires-better-than-foam-filled-tires">Are air-filled tires better than foam-filled tires?</h3>

<p>Air-filled tires provide superior natural suspension and are better for off-road usage. Nevertheless, they are vulnerable to leaks. Foam-filled tires are “puncture-proof” and require less maintenance, making them ideal for urban environments.</p>

<h3 id="can-i-take-my-pushchair-on-a-plane" id="can-i-take-my-pushchair-on-a-plane">Can I take my pushchair on a plane?</h3>

<p>The majority of airline companies allow passengers to inspect in a pushchair at the boarding gate free of charge. Compact “cabin-approved” designs can even be folded and saved in the overhead locker, supplied they satisfy the airline company&#39;s specific measurements.</p>

<h3 id="how-long-do-pushchairs-normally-last" id="how-long-do-pushchairs-normally-last">How long do pushchairs normally last?</h3>

<p>A high-quality pushchair is developed to last through at least two kids. With proper maintenance, a premium model can operate effectively for 5 to 7 years.</p>

<h3 id="what-is-the-difference-in-between-a-stroller-and-a-pushchair" id="what-is-the-difference-in-between-a-stroller-and-a-pushchair">What is the difference in between a stroller and a pushchair?</h3>

<p>The terms are frequently utilized interchangeably. Nevertheless, historically, a “pushchair” described a system where the infant faces the moms and dad or the world and can lie flat (suitable from birth), while a “stroller” was a lighter, forward-facing system for older toddlers.</p>
